United States Average Weekly Earnings for Employees in the Trade, Transportation, and Utilities Industry in January, 2024 (Not Seas Adj.)
Updated on March 23, 2026.
According to data from the US BLS, in January 2024, North Dakota had the highest average weekly earnings for employees in the trade, transportation, and utilities industry ($1,221.65) (not seasonally adjusted), followed by Hawaii ($1,170.66), and California ($1,067.22).
The chart and table below shows the average weekly earnings for employees in the trade, transportation, and utilities industry for different states in January 2024.

| State | Avg. Weekly Earnings ($) |
|---|---|
| North Dakota | 1221.65 |
| Hawaii | 1170.66 |
| California | 1067.22 |
| Washington | 1028.21 |
| Arizona | 1017.93 |
| Oregon | 1004.85 |
| New York | 986.44 |
| Utah | 983.42 |
| New Jersey | 976.63 |
| Alaska | 966.01 |
| Texas | 952.15 |
| Oklahoma | 947.75 |
| Connecticut | 939.63 |
| Ohio | 939.62 |
| Massachusetts | 938.19 |
| South Dakota | 933.48 |
| Illinois | 932.18 |
| Wisconsin | 931.94 |
| Michigan | 931.06 |
| Missouri | 929.32 |
| Wyoming | 926.8 |
| Kentucky | 926.48 |
| Tennessee | 917.07 |
| Iowa | 911.18 |
| Virginia | 901.18 |
| Vermont | 897.35 |
| North Carolina | 895.81 |
| Montana | 893.34 |
| Louisiana | 888.3 |
| Florida | 883.63 |
| Colorado | 880.31 |
| New Hampshire | 879.53 |
| Idaho | 878.72 |
| Nevada | 878.46 |
| Pennsylvania | 870.23 |
| Kansas | 869.55 |
| New Mexico | 869.46 |
| Indiana | 868.23 |
| Arkansas | 860.95 |
| Alabama | 860.22 |
| Georgia | 854.1 |
| South Carolina | 849.2 |
| Nebraska | 847.45 |
| Minnesota | 842.52 |
| Maryland | 841.6 |
| Mississippi | 829.69 |
| District of Columbia | 824.34 |
| Rhode Island | 819.34 |
| Maine | 797.53 |
| West Virginia | 788.11 |
| Delaware | 782.8 |
